Moms in Prayer - Wednesday mornings in the Church Library
"The effective, fervent prayer of the righteous avails much."  James 5:16b
 
TCS has a tradition of moms praying together for the school as part of a larger group called Moms in Touch International.  This has been an invaluable tradition for decades when a grandmother who was raising her grandchildren, who were attending TCS at the time, began the prayer group at the school. It continued every year with the exception of the 20-21 school year.  We seek to intercede for all of the ongoing and current needs of the school as well as any needs teachers and staff share.  This year the group plans to meet on:
 
Wednesday mornings-- after drop-off - 9:00 
In the Church Library
 
If you have young children, feel free to bring them with a book.  When I was first involved in Moms in Touch, my now 10th graders were preschoolers.  They played and read books (as quietly as possible) while I prayed with the other moms.  I cannot think of a better legacy to instill in our children than that of intercessory prayer.
